AWS_FAQ

ELB pre-warming 이란?

2015.09.09 21:37

호스트웨이 조회 수:9195

ELB는 부하 분산(load balancing) 및 고가용성(High Availablity)을 제공

ELB는 하나의 장비가 아니라 내부적으로 여러 리소스가 조합되어 S/W로 서비스 되고

 ec2 scale out하는 것 처럼 내부적으로는 부하가 발생시 그에 따라 ELB도 scale out 이 진행 됩니다.

하지만  갑작스런 트래픽 폭증이나 warming up  없이 서비스 중인 시스템을  이관 할 때는

scale out 이 진행 될 동안 감당을 못해  서비스 장애가 발생할 확율이 높아집니다.

사전 아마존에 aws elb pre-warming을 신청하여 대응 할 수 있습니다.

신청 예제) 

 (연결된 instance 의 type이나 수량에 따라서 적절하게 신청하세요 ec2 type이 낮거나, 수량이 적으면 신청이 거절됩니다.)


  • ELB Name: example_hostway_elb_xxx~~~
  • Start date for elevated traffic patterns: 2015. 9. 10
  • End date for elevated traffic patterns: 2015. 9. 20
  • Traffic delta OR request rate expected at surge(in Requests Per Second): 1,000 to 10,000 in 5 minutes
  • Average amount of data passing through the ELB per request/response pair(In Bytes): 10Kbytes
  • Rate of traffic increase: 50,000/sec
  • Are keep-alives used on the back-end?: keep-alives 사용 유무 입력
  • Percent of traffic using SSL termination on the ELB: 트래픽에서 SSL termination이 차지하는 비율 입력
  • Number of AZ’s that will be used for this event/load balancer: ELB 로드 밸런서가 트래픽을 분산하고 있는 가용 영역 개수 입력
  • Is the back-end scaled to event/spike levels? If no, how many and what type of instances and when will they be scaled?: Auto Scaling으로 확장하는 기준, EC2 인스턴스 유형 및 개수 입력
  • Use-case description: 사용 계획 입력
  • Traffic pattern description: 트래픽 패턴 설명 입력



AWS support url

https://console.aws.amazon.com/support/home?region=eu-west-1#/case/create?issueType=technical&type=technical_support


AWS support level에 따라 기술 지원이 달라지니 아래 url을 참고하세요.

https://console.aws.amazon.com/support/plans/home?region=eu-west-1#/


elb troubleshooting guide

http://docs.aws.amazon.com/ko_kr/ElasticLoadBalancing/latest/DeveloperGuide/elb-troubleshooting.html


pre-warming 가이드

http://aws.amazon.com/articles/1636185810492479

번호 제목 글쓴이 날짜 조회 수
51 Sub 도메인 확장 호스트웨이 2016.04.27 313
50 S3 성능 고려 사항 호스트웨이 2016.04.27 377
49 AWS divice farm 지원 단말기 목록 검색 호스트웨이 2015.09.13 464
48 s3cmd multipart uploads 호스트웨이 2015.09.11 466
47 AWS ELB TCP 적용 방법 호스트웨이 2016.06.01 726
46 AWS S3 파일 타임스템프 확인 호스트웨이 2015.09.13 752
45 aws cli preview 기능 사용 호스트웨이 2015.09.13 796
44 Linux AWS CLI 환경 구성 호스트웨이 2015.09.13 894
43 AWS Lamda 이용하여 cron 처럼 사용 file 호스트웨이 2015.09.13 968
42 T2 instance 특징은 무엇인가요? 호스트웨이 2016.04.28 1085
41 AWS key 파일 변환 (pem.key -> ppk.key) 호스트웨이 2015.09.22 1251
40 EC2 Type 별 EIP를 몇개까지 할당 할 수 있나? 호스트웨이 2016.04.28 1410
39 AWS를 직접 사용하는 것과 호스트웨이를 통했을 때의 차이점은 무엇인가요? 호스트웨이 2015.10.26 1431
38 sub domain route53 으로 위임 호스트웨이 2015.09.25 1491
37 AWS Linux Bastion instance SSH Tunneling 사용 방법 file 호스트웨이 2016.06.01 1798
36 apache와 iELB 간 이슈 호스트웨이 2015.09.06 1848
35 S3 DNS CNAME 설정 주의 사항 호스트웨이 2015.09.15 1848
34 AWS EC2 instance 시동시 cloud-init가 hostname을 IP 주소로 설정 호스트웨이 2015.09.13 1968
33 WEB 서비스 ELB 사용 시, Health check 설정 방법(권장) 호스트웨이 2015.09.22 2182
32 AWS EC2 Instance 생성 후 접속 호스트웨이 2015.09.08 2333